Rush at 50 Summary

Rush at 50 by Daniel Bukszpan

A beautifully produced, photo-packed celebration of the beloved rock trio,Rush at 50examines the history of the Canadian rockers through the lens of 50 milestone events and an illustrated gatefold timeline.

Formed in Toronto in 1968, Rush became one of the most popular and best-selling bands in rock history, thanks to their tireless effort and imaginative, ever-evolving music. Thisrichly illustratedand entertainingly written book from Rush expert and music journalist Dan Bukszpan pays tribute to the trio on the 50th anniversaryof their debut album by curating and examining 50 of the most significant milestones in their career.

Bukszpan covers everything down through the decades:
  • Thebands formation by bassist Geddy Lee and guitarist Alex Lifeson in suburban Toronto and their early gigs and tours opening for the likes of Kiss
  • Their breakthrough in the United States thanks to a Cleveland DJ
  • The role of co-founding drummer John Rutsey
  • Rushs early Led Zeppelininfluenced efforts and their breakthrough,2112
  • Thebands ever-evolving musical style through the 1970s and 1980s
  • The controversial influence of novelist Ayn Rand on Neil Pearts lyrics
  • Geddy Lees instantly recognizable vocal style
  • Recording sessions with various producers in Wales, Quebec, and elsewhere

In examining 50 touchstones, Buszpan presents a unique look at Rushs career arc from Toronto bar band to international mega-platinum stadium fillers. Every page is illustrated withstunning concert and candid offstage photography, including gig posters, 7-inch picture sleeves, ticket stubs, and more.

The result isan epic tributeto one of the most influential and admired bands in rock historyin a milestone year.

About Daniel Bukszpan

Daniel Bukszpan has been a freelance writer for over 25 years. He has written for such publications as Fortune, CNBC, Conde Nast Traveler, and more. He is the author ofThe Encyclopedia of Heavy Metal, The Encyclopedia of New Wave, The Art of Brutal Legend, Woodstock: 50 Years of Peace and Music,Ozzy at 75, and Rush at 50. Dan also contributed to the Quarto titles AC/DC: High-Voltage Rock N Roll, Iron Maiden: The Ultimate Unauthorized History of the Beast, Metallica: The Complete Illustrated History, and Rush: The Illustrated History.
